Ok, for the 5th and final day of bothering Dr. L, I finally got through. Thank GOD! I have my lab results!!
I now went from hypothyroidism to hyperthyroidism. I sort of knew this already tho. But he said he thinks that's what's causing me to be flushed. My Free T4 was 2.37 and my TSH (even tho I know it doesn't matter) was 0. He moved my meds from 150mcg to 125mcg and recheck in 6 weeks. (or more) So we'll see if that helps.
He is FINALLY starting me on GH!! I'm so happy about that! Although, he's worried about my carpal tunnel. I developed that in the last few weeks as well and he said if he gives me GH it may make it worse. *grrr* He says he will order the GH, but he wants me to have a local doc check out the carpel tunnel. So I have an appt on Friday with my PCP.
And at 6 months, my cortisol is still only 1.5 and my ACTH is 22. I'm concerned that my ACTH keeps going up, but he wasn't. The range goes up to 48, but still. With no cortisol and normal ACTH, he just said I'm secondary addisons. I don't know tho. It's still somewhat worrisome. But good nonetheless!
He wants me to up my hydro to 25mg too, which he thinks will help the other aches and pains I have. I really don't want to go back up tho. So he has me down now officially as panhypopit. He said we will continue to reevaluate that, as he still thinks my pit will kick in. I don't know tho.
Overall this was a good report and everything I wanted to hear. Now if we can just get a move on it, so I feel better already!
